Our Vision

  Our vision is to provide a healing process for sober residents after release from treatment programs by offering a safe, sober, and restorative environment for our residents to establish a new direction in their lives with focus on accountability and peer support as they work toward a new life with dignity and respect.

Mission Statement

St. Zachary's Haven is a sanctuary for renewal and restoration. We provide clean, safe housing and support compassionate recovery within a farm setting for individuals struggling with addiction.  

About Us

Serving Men in Recovery

 We provide a structured, supportive community living environment designed specifically for men in recovery. Our property offers housing across two historic buildings, each featuring shared kitchens, bathrooms, and comfortable common areas that encourage connection. In addition to safe, stable housing, residents receive case management and peer support to help navigate recovery goals, employment, and personal growth. Our barn serves as a central gathering space for community meetings, peer groups, and educational programming—fostering a strong sense of community and shared purpose every day. 

Farm Living in a Special Setting

 Located on 13 scenic acres in rural Warren County, Ohio, our farm offers a unique blend of peaceful surroundings and active, recovery-focused living. We sit directly along the Little Miami River and Loveland Bike Trail, providing easy access to miles of outdoor recreation, and our property features a stocked pond with fishing poles available, an in-ground swimming pool, and a dedicated exercise room. Residents also have the opportunity to engage with the land through gardening and animal care, as we grow vegetables and raise animals right here on the farm. Products from our farm are shared with the community through our on-site Haven Market, creating a meaningful connection between our residents and the broader community while reinforcing purpose and responsibility in recovery. 

Our Difference

 At our sober living farm, recovery goes beyond abstinence—it becomes a way of life rooted in purpose, responsibility, and connection. What sets us apart is our flexible, community-centered approach, where residents are encouraged to participate in the daily rhythm of farm life. Whether engaging in hands-on activities like caring for animals and working the land or focusing on employment, education, and personal goals off-site, each resident has the opportunity to build structure, accountability, and confidence in a way that fits their journey. Surrounded by a peaceful, natural environment, our program fosters genuine peer support, personal growth, and real-world life skills—helping residents create a recovery that is both sustainable and meaningful.
